Bayern Munich 2001 Champions League winner Bixente Lizarazu watched last week’s Champions League match between the Bavarians and Paris Saint-Germain with great interest.
What he saw from Bayern Munich’s defense, however, was something he did not like.
“If Bayern play so naively by leaving such a large space behind their defense, Mbappe will express himself in the same way,” Lizarazu told Telefoot (as captured by beIN Sports).“Mbappe is really strong in there. He’s the best forward in the world on the break or in quick attacks. Can Bayern correct that, or not?”

As for Lizarazu’s thought on Mbappe, the 51-year-old thinks Paris Saint-Germain should do everything possible to hang on to the young talent.
“I would do anything to keep Mbappe. If he has to leave, Kane would be a good reinforcement for PSG,” Lizarazu said. “You need a center-forward who is both a goal scorer and who can play, such as Lewandowski can do at Bayern.”
